What is Microwave Communication?
Microwave communication is a line-of-sight, high-frequency radio link used to transmit data over long distances without physical cables. These links are essential for connecting telecom towers, BTS, BSCs, remote offices, and areas where fiber deployment is unfeasible or cost-prohibitive.
It involves the installation of parabolic antennas, outdoor radio units, waveguides, and indoor networking interfaces, precisely aligned for maximum signal strength and minimal interference.
Our Microwave Service Offerings
1. Site Survey & LOS (Line of Sight) Analysis
Physical site inspection for microwave feasibility
LOS clearance verification using GPS tools and software (Pathloss, Mapinfo, Google Earth)
Tower height calculations and antenna positioning
Fresnel zone analysis and clutter evaluation
2. Microwave Equipment Installation
Mounting of microwave dishes, brackets, and mounts on towers
Installation of IDU (Indoor Unit) and ODU (Outdoor Unit)
Earthing, lightning protection, and weatherproofing
Cabling: waveguides, IF cables, Ethernet, and power
Installation of waveguide dehydrators (if needed)
3. Microwave Link Commissioning
Equipment configuration (IP, VLAN, Frequency, TX Power)
Integration with transport network (MPLS, SDH, IP/MPLS)
Software upgrades and SNMP configurations
Alarm verification and threshold settings
Real-time monitoring and traffic test validation
4. Link Alignment Services
Fine and coarse azimuth & elevation alignment using field tools
RSSI, RSL, and BER optimization
Cross-polarization and frequency interference analysis
Use of spectrum analyzer for frequency sweeps
Link budget validation and tuning
5. Testing & Acceptance
End-to-end link testing: Throughput, latency, packet loss
BER (Bit Error Rate) testing and Ethernet loopback
Link uptime analysis with statistical logs
Documentation of final link quality (RSL reports, alignment angles)
Handover for ATP (Acceptance Test Protocol).
